Overview of Traditional Condenser Microphones

Traditional condenser microphones have been the cornerstone of professional recording studios for decades. They utilize a capacitor to convert sound into electrical signals, offering high sensitivity and detailed sound reproduction. These microphones are often preferred for vocals, instruments, and studio environments where capturing nuance is essential.

Features of Traditional Condenser Microphones

  • Capacitor-based transducer for high fidelity
  • Requires phantom power supply
  • Wide frequency response
  • Typically more delicate construction
  • Various polar patterns available (cardioid, omni, figure-8)

Comparative Analysis

Sound Quality and Sensitivity

Condenser microphones excel in capturing subtle nuances and providing a high level of detail. The Rode Podmic 2026, being a dynamic microphone, offers robust sound but may lack the fine detail of condenser mics in certain applications. However, its focused pickup pattern helps reduce background noise, which is advantageous in noisy environments.

Durability and Use Cases

The Rode Podmic 2026 is built for durability and ease of use, making it ideal for live streaming, podcasting, and field recording. Traditional condenser microphones, while more delicate, are preferred in controlled studio settings for producing the highest fidelity recordings.

Connectivity and Power

The Rode Podmic 2026 offers flexible connectivity options, including USB-C for direct connection to computers and XLR for professional audio interfaces. Traditional condenser microphones typically rely on XLR connections and require phantom power, adding complexity but ensuring high-quality signal transfer.
